Recursive search method applied to a nonequilibrium phase transition

摘要

In this work, we extend the recursive search method to locate the critical point and to obtain the relevant critical exponents of a nonequilibrium phase transition. In particular, the method is applied to the contact process which presents a nonequilibrium phase transition between a steady active to a single inactive absorbing state belonging to the directed percolation universality class. We present the appropriate scaling analysis which allows for precise estimates of the critical parameters with a relatively small computational effort. The proposed scheme can be directly applied to general model systems presenting nonequilibrium transitions into absorbing states including reaction-diffusion and pair contact processes.
